Bet You Didn’t Know These Tricks to Spice-up Your Resume

Your resume is the key to getting inside the world of work and opportunities. It is the mirror of your qualifications and capabilities that prospective employers first see when deciding whether to hire you. Regardless of whether you’re just starting or are a seasoned professional, a resume allows you to make the most of chances that come your way.

Considering how important it can be, would you like to present a prospective employer with a dull and run-of-the-mill resume which is similar to many others, or would you like to stand out? No points for answering that one!

Let’s take a look at how you can ensure that your resume is the best of the lot.

Update it regularly

Always ensure that your resume stays updated. Not showcasing recent experiences or certifications won’t do you any good. Also, keep making updates as and when they happen in your career. Making edits just before an interview could ruin the entire document and the effect you were hoping for.

Keep it interesting

Your resume needs to hold the reader’s attention. Therefore, while creating or updating it, add keywords to it based on the job description. Some websites help you with adding keywords based on your role. Use them. Don’t use a standardized template for all your applications; instead, add a few lines about the company and how you feel you would fit into it.

Address the target audience

Keep in mind that your potential employer may not be interested in knowing everything about you, but only those details that are most relevant for the job role you are applying to. For this reason, it is a good idea to cite only the details that fit the position you are applying for and focus strictly on your relevant accomplishments.

Integrate information intelligently

Avoid adding new things at the end of the document. Instead, integrate such information expertly within context. This will help avoid the feeling of a shambled and out-of-context resume.

Aim to be concise

It is also essential to make the document as concise as possible since this is just meant to give your prospective employers a glimpse into your professional qualities. You can always talk to them in detail over the interview.

Always proofread

Always remember to proofread after you make an update. Proofreading will allow you to check for formatting errors, inconsistencies, spelling mistakes, and more. This will also let you scan your document for issues with capitalization and abbreviations. Do make sure the resume doesn’t have any grammar mistakes.
